How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 02222?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
02222 Studio Apartments | $2,858 | $1,000 | $13,000 |
02222 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,631 | $1,155 | $16,914 |
02222 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,305 | $1,250 | $32,243 |
02222 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,835 | $1,000 | $41,779 |
02222 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,160 | $900 | $20,000 |
02222 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,696 | $875 | $10,000+ |
02222 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,157 | $1,025 | $9,500 |
